Q. What is Stored Program Control ?
Stored Program Control:Modern digital computers use stored programmed concept. Here, a program or a set of instructions to the computer is stored in its memory and instructions are executed automatically one by one by processor. Carrying out the exchange control functions through programs stored in the memory of a computer led to nomenclature stored program control (SPC). An immediate consequence of program control is full-scale automation of exchange functions and introduction of a range of new services to users.
